Goodwill Industries of New Mexico is a nonprofit organization dedicated to assisting individuals in the region with job placement and access to various social services. Through revenues generated from the sale of donated items, including clothing and furniture, the organization funds its programs, ensuring that 88 cents of every dollar supports community offerings.
Among its many initiatives, Goodwill provides specialized programs for veterans, including housing assistance and job training, as well as a range of career services for the general public. With over 200 free classes available, Goodwill strives to empower New Mexicans by improving job skills and facilitating employment opportunities.
